Address

SVWRqUb6RPc2Pec5uAqs5zoSVfH7YbsbpP

0 SATOX

Confirmed
Total Received1.86838044 SATOX
Total Sent1.86838044 SATOX
Final Balance0 SATOX
No. Transactions2

Transactions

SVWRqUb6RPc2Pec5uAqs5zoSVfH7YbsbpP1.86838044 SATOX